启动Ubuntu时出现错误信息“信号超出范围92KHz – 58Hz”。 有什么问题,我该如何解决?

我的显示器有一个类比连接。 首先我安装Windows 7,然后我安装Ubuntu 11.10,当这个安装完成后我重新启动了PC。

任何时候我打开电脑我都会看到BIOS配置(Windows显示相同,这是正常的),然后出现Loading system ,3秒后(没有启动加载程序)我在显示器上收到此消息:

 Signal out of range 92KHz - 58Hz 

因为我在屏幕上看不到任何内容,所以我等待大约10秒,然后出现Ubuntu。 要启动Windows,我必须按向下箭头键5次或更多次并按Enter键

此消息显示在不同的位置,因为当我按Ctrl + Alt + F1 (打开TTY)时此消息再次出现,然后我按Ctrl + Alt + F7并出现我的桌面出现图形问题
所以我认为问题是由于图形驱动程序。

你好像在问两件事。

  1. 我在显示器上收到此消息Signal out of range 92KHz - 58Hz

    我不知道这是什么意思。 我的猜测是,Ubuntu试图用于显示的配置设置有问题。 当它尝试应用它们时会出现此错误。 在此之后,Ubuntu可能只使用有效的设置。

    我不知道你怎么能解决这个问题。 我会尝试…这只是一个猜测…是打开系统设置>显示,单击Detect Displays ,然后尝试更改分辨率。

    希望别人能有更好的答案……

  2. 我无法加载Windows!

    如果不了解您的系统,安装了哪些操作系统,以及安装和/或变得不可用的顺序,很难为此提出可行的解决方案。

    在“ Bootinfo摘要 ”中获取实用程序boot-repair提供的信息也很有帮助 。 如果您按照以下说明创建Bootinfo摘要,然后更新您的问题以包含摘要的链接,它将帮助我们建议您如何解决问题启动窗口。

如何使用boot-repair提供“Bootinfo Summary”

由于您仍然可以启动Ubuntu,因此您可以直接安装并运行Boot-Repair工具并使用它来Create a Bootinfo summary

首先,使用apt-get安装Boot-Repair工具。 执行此操作的终端命令是

 sudo add-apt-repository ppa:yannubuntu/boot-repair sudo apt-get update sudo apt-get install -y boot-repair 
  1. 完成后,输入命令boot-repair以启动该工具。
  2. 稍有延迟后, boot-repair将提示您下载最新版本。 由于您刚刚安装了最新版本,请回答No
  3. 如果boot-repair要求安装pastebinit软件包,请回答“ Yes
  4. 该工具现在将扫描您的系统并(最终)显示下图所示的窗口。 单击Create a Bootinfo summary框/按钮。 这将收集有关系统引导配置的信息,但不会进行任何更改。

    Initial Boot-Repair Window

  5. 创建bootinfo摘要后, boot-repair将显示包含URL的消息,该URL应如下所示: http://paste.ubuntu.com/123456/http://paste.ubuntu.com/123456/

    请更新/编辑您的问题并添加此url。 此链接指向的pastebin中的信息(我希望)可以帮助我们诊断问题。


回复评论@ 2012-05-06 23:18:37Z

任何时候我打开电脑我都会看到BIOS配置,然后出现Loading system ,3秒后出现[信号超出范围]消息。

我不确定我明白。 我熟悉的大多数PC在启动/启动时都会显示BIOS POST消息 。 您现在看到的“ BIOS配置 ”在某种程度上是否有所不同? 或者,在安装Windows时,您是否看到过相同的BIOS消息?

看到Loading system消息后,请立即尝试按住Shift键。 这应该会使GRUB启动菜单出现。 可以?

您的系统在显示Grub和控制台Linux时遇到问题。 这是一个目前正在研究的grub问题。(实际上在bug跟踪器上停滞不前)要进入Windows,启动,几秒钟,然后尝试按 (向下箭头键)5次(我看着你的pastebin entry)然后按Enter键。 请注意,这适用于OP的配置,因此如果您的GRUB配置与OP不同,那么这可能对您没有帮助。

如果失败,请在loading system时按住shift并尝试按下5次,然后输入,希望启动Windows。 不幸的是,在你弄清楚菜单的顺序之前,你正在黑暗中摸索。 我试试ATI显卡。 启动修复无济于事,但您可以尝试使用lilo而不是Grub。

或者,您可以尝试通过ntldr加载Grub,这样您在进入盲目grub之前就可以选择Windows,但这并不理想, 应该避免 。 我目前用我的Nvidia卡看到了这个问题,这个解决方法还没有让我失望。

您有“超出范围”错误:

 Signal out of range 92KHz - 58Hz 

解决它:

  1. 运行引导修复
  2. 单击Advanced options
  3. 转到GRUB options
  4. 勾选out-of-range选项
  5. 应用

我的问题是我看不到GRUB选项,所以Ubuntu会在10秒后自动启动。 虽然那段时间我看到错误消息Signal out of range ,但在那之后我看到Ubuntu没有问题。

为了解决这个问题,我安装了GRUB-customizer并将应用程序的分辨率从800x600*16b更改为800x600*32b

现在我可以看到GRUB的不同选项让我选择Ubuntu,Windows等。


注意:您可以从软件中心安装GRUB定制器。